Water softener installation services involve the setup of specialized systems designed to treat hard water. These systems typically include the placement of a water softener unit, connecting it to the existing plumbing, and ensuring proper operation. The process may involve assessing the property's water supply, selecting the appropriate size and type of softener, and installing the necessary valves, tanks, and controls to enable effective water conditioning. Professional service providers ensure that the installation adheres to plumbing standards and functions efficiently within the property's existing infrastructure.
Hard water can cause a variety of problems in residential and commercial properties. It often leads to mineral buildup on fixtures, appliances, and plumbing fixtures, which can reduce their lifespan and efficiency. Additionally, hard water can leave unsightly spots on dishes and glassware, and it may cause skin irritation or dryness for residents. Installing a water softener helps mitigate these issues by removing excess minerals like calcium and magnesium, resulting in softened water that is gentler on plumbing and appliances and improves overall water quality.

The overview below groups typical Water Softener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Des Moines,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Installation Costs - The cost for installing a water softener typically ranges from $1,500 to $3,500, depending on the system type and complexity of the installation. For example, basic models may be closer to $1,500, while more advanced systems can approach $3,500.
System Pricing - The price of water softening units varies widely, with common models costing between $400 and $2,500. Factors influencing price include capacity, features, and brand, with larger or more feature-rich units on the higher end.
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include plumbing modifications or upgrades, which can add $200 to $800 to the overall expense. These costs depend on existing plumbing and the complexity of the installation site.
Service Fees - Professional installation services typically range from $300 to $1,000, depending on the local market and the installer’s rates. This fee covers labor, setup, and initial system testing by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How long does a water softener installation typically take? Installation times can vary depending on the property and system type, but most installations are completed within a few hours by local service providers.
Is a water softener installation suitable for all homes? Many homes with hard water issues can benefit from a water softener, but a consultation with local pros can determine suitability based on specific water conditions.
Will installing a water softener affect my water pressure? Properly installed systems are designed to maintain water pressure; however, a professional can ensure optimal setup to prevent any pressure issues.
What types of water softeners are available for installation? Common options include salt-based ion exchange systems and salt-free alternatives, with local pros able to recommend the best choice for each home.
Are there any permits required for water softener installation? Permit requirements vary by location; local service providers can advise on any local regulations or permits needed for installation.
